Hawaiian Airlines previews Hawaiian language flights

To commemorate, honor and encourage Hawaiian culture, Hawaiian Airlines flight HA18, which left the Honolulu International Airport last week, was staffed with flight attendants who spoke in both English and olelo Hawaii (Hawaiian language). Top places to visit in Waialua town on the North Shore

The next time you’re headed to Oahu’s North Shore think about heading into Waialua. Nestled between Haleiwa and Mokuleia, Waialua is a former sugar mill town that is a great place to escape the crowds.
